Introduction

Endowed with subtle and delicate looks, yet also boasting astonishing speed and dynamism, Aston Martin’s V12 Vantage S Roadster offers a thrilling experience for any sportscar enthusiast.

Weighing just 14kg more than its coupé counterpart, the roadster loses next to nothing as a driver’s car; with the roof up, it also boasts refinement to match its sibling.

Safety

Dual-stage front and side airbags provide exceptional protection for the driver and front passenger, whilst quick-deploying anti-roll bars are designed to prevent injury if a catastrophic accident results in the vehicle being overturned. Such a traumatic experience, however, is made much less likely by the inclusion of a multitude of active safety features, such as ABS, Dynamic Stability Control, Electronic Brakeforce Distribution, Emergency Brake Assist, Traction Control, Hydraulic Brake Assist, Positive Torque Control, and Hill Start Assist.​Together with the extremely effective ventilated carbon-ceramic disc brakes, these measures render the V12 Vantage S Roadster stable and poised in any circumstances.

Design

The sleek and poised appearance of the V12 Vantage S Roadster, accentuated by such delightful touches as the carbon fibre air intakes, side strakes and mirror caps, along with door handles that are flush with the bodywork.

More prosaically, the extruded-aluminium structure is extremely light and strong, meaning that it avoids the problems with additional weight and structural weakness that can hamper less well-designed convertible cars.​


The rear deck of the car is refined and of a modest size, despite containing a soft-top roof mechanism that can be electronically raised or lowered in 14 seconds at speeds under 30mph.

Inside, the car's immensely customisable cabin offers craftsmanship of the highest quality, with leather bucket seats and hand-stitched upholstery complementing clear, simple instruments.

Technology

The V12 Vantage S Roadster is powered by the manufacturer's AM28 V12 engine. Possessed of a mighty 565bhp, the 6.0 litre unit also delivers peak torque of 620Nm – resulting in a 0-62mph acceleration figure of 3.9 seconds and a top speed of over 200mph.

The extraordinary power of this engine is yoked to a seven-speed, automated-manual Sportshift III transmission, which supplies a constant surge of power during aggressive acceleration.


The vehicle's interior boasts a variety of technology as standard, from ambient “Organic Electroluminscent" displays to rear-parking assistance sensors. Bluetooth® connectivity keeps you in touch with the outside world, while a 160W Aston Martin audio system allows you to listen to your favourite music.

As an optional extra, this can be replaced by a Bang & Olufsen BeoSound 1000W Audio System, which heightens the driving experience still further.

Technical Specification

Dimensions
Vehicle Length 4385 mm
Vehicle Width 2022 mm (inc. mirrors)
Vehicle Height 1260 mm
Wheelbase 2600mm
Weight
Unladen Weight (DIN) 1745 kg
Engine
Engine / Cylinders V12
Maximum Revs 6,750 rpm
Max Torque 620 nm @ 5750rpm
Max Power 537 PS (565 bhp) @ 6,750 rpm
Performance
Top Speed 201 mph
Acceleration 0-60 mph / 3.9 seconds
Efficiency
Combined Cycle 19.2 mpg
Urban Cycle 12.6 mpg
CO2 343 g/km
